Output 67a03a1201bd1a415d0c06076f00dbda39e8b9c92eb30017602eef9e44d8d761:21

value
1192928595
script pubkey
OP_0 OP_PUSHBYTES_20 e80c5a611ac6008c43c1fa5d525cbbe7d69e2908
address
ltc1qaqx95cg6ccqgcs7plfw4yh9multfu2ggjqa3n5
transaction
67a03a1201bd1a415d0c06076f00dbda39e8b9c92eb30017602eef9e44d8d761
spent
true